Japan Airlines jet wing strikes Delta Air Lines plane

6/2/2025 6:06
The right wing of a Japan

Airlines jet struck the tail of a Delta Air Lines

plane while the aircraft were taxiing at Seattle-Tacoma

International Airport on Wednesday, the Federal Aviation

Administration said.



The FAA paused some flights to the airport as a result of

the incident that occurred around 10:40 a.m. local time (1840

GMT). The agency said it will investigate the incident.



The Delta 737-800 with 142 passengers was bound for Puerto

Vallarta and was waiting for deicing when it was struck by the

Japan Airlines Boeing 787-9 Dreamliner after it had

landed from Tokyo. Delta said there were no reports of injuries

and it will transfer passengers to another plane.



Delta said it will work with the FAA and others to

investigate.



Japan Airlines did not immediately respond to a request for

comment.
